    Both Lewis and Wlad have skull crushing power. Trying to figure out who hits harder is like splitting hairs.
    Stewart held the pads. So he's be a good gauge, but there is a difference between pad work and actual fighting. Lewis' timing was better and he knew how to sneak those punches in, He could hide his right behind a jab. So I could see where someone sparring him would be more jarred by his shots than by the hard but more predictable shots of Wlad.
